GivingTuesday Statistics

Donations on December 1, 2020 totaled an estimated $2.47 billion. (GivingTuesday Statement)

 

As of 2019, 55% percent of the population is familiar with GivingTuesday (Horizon Media Study)

 

34.8 million people participated in GivingTuesday 2020, a 29% increase over 2019. (Blackbaud Giving Tuesday Report)

 

The online average gift size exceeded $147.00 during GivingTuesday 2018 (14.8% above the yearly average).

 

GivingTuesday online giving has grown 518% since its creation in 2012. (Blackbaud Giving Tuesday Report)

 

More than 10,000 nonprofit organizations, worldwide, participate in GivingTuesday each year. (Blackbaud Giving Tuesday Trends)

 

GivingTuesday 2018 recorded $380 million dollars in donations in the US alone. (Nonprofit Source – Giving Tuesday Statistics)

 

17% of online donation form views were on mobile devices during GivingTuesday. (Nonprofit Source – Giving Tuesday Statistics)

 

GivingTuesday 2018 generated 14.2 billion social media mentions. (HubSpot – Giving Tuesday Social Media)

 

150 countries participated in GivingTuesday 2018. (givingtuesday.org)

 

3.6 million online gifts were made on GivingTuesday 2018. (givingtuesday.org)

 

46% of donors worldwide had never heard of GivingTuesday before the event. (Nonprofit Source – Giving Tuesday Statistics)

 

63% of donors give only on GivingTuesday. (givingtuesday.org)

 

Repeat donor retention is 64% (23% first-time donor retention) during GivingTuesday. (Bloomerang – Giving Tuesday Retention Report)

 

79.2% of volunteers give during GivingTuesday (leverage your volunteers!)

 

GivingTuesday (total donations) grew by 38.8% between 2017 and 2018. (givingtuesday.org)

 

Blackbaud processed more than $60.9 million in online donations from U.S. nonprofits on GivingTuesday 2017 (NpEngage)

 

42.1% of people volunteer because they were asked to do so (use GivingTuesday as an opportunity to ask).

 

Faith-based organizations receive the largest percentage of GivingTuesday online donations.(Nonprofit Source – Giving Tuesday Statistics)

 

Facebook processed the most GivingTuesday donations in 2018 ($125 Million). (Facebook Social Good)

 

GivingTuesday donations has grown by 100% in the last 2 years. (Winspire)

 

Facebook matched $2 Million in GivingTuesday gifts (PayPal matched $7 Million). (The Nonprofit Times)

 

Billboards were one of the most effective advertising trends for GivingTuesday 2018. (Salesforce)

 

Tips to consider based on the statistics

GivingTuesday offers nonprofits a great opportunity to communicate their mission to both new and existing donors and volunteers. Here are 5 tips to consider when creating your organization's GivingTuesday 2022 strategy.
 
  • Promote your nonprofit's Giving Tuesday messaging on social media.
  • Use Giving Tuesday as an opportunity to reach volunteers.
  • Ask people to volunteer/donate to your organization.
  • Consider investing in outbound advertising.
  • Develop a strategy that stands out from the crowd.
